#!/usr/bin/env bash
# NOTE: This script was written before the content moved to Hugo/Docsy
# so don't run it. Keeping it for now as some of it may be useful
# for content validation in a Hugo/Docsy world.
# Requires bash >=4.3
# Requires realpath
# Script to check the markdown in a repo to ensure that all external links
# are not broken.
# It writes checked URLs to a dated file so that on subsequent runs
# on the same day it can just check against the file for speed.
# To not check this file set force=true.
set -eo pipefail
shopt -s globstar
# Any files to not check at all
file_deny_list=(
./VERSION.md
)
# Any link locations to not check
# The VS Code one seems to 403 most of the time, may be rate limited?
url_deny_list=(
"https://github.com/gchq/stroom/issues/\1"
"https://code.visualstudio.com/docs/editor/userdefinedsnippets"
)
indent=" "
setup_echo_colours() {
# Exit the script on any error
set -e
# shellcheck disable=SC2034
if [ "${MONOCHROME}" = true ]; then
RED=''
GREEN=''
YELLOW=''
BLUE=''
BLUE2=''
DGREY=''
NC='' # No Colour
else
RED='\033[1;31m'
GREEN='\033[1;32m'
YELLOW='\033[1;33m'
BLUE='\033[1;34m'
BLUE2='\033[1;34m'
DGREY='\e[90m'
NC='\033[0m' # No Colour
fi
}
setup_debuging() {
if [ ! "${IS_DEBUG}" = true ]; then
# redefine the debug funcs as no ops, saves having a test in each call to
# the debug func
eval "
debug() {
true
}
debug_value() {
true
}"
fi
}
# Requires setup_debuging to be run once
debug_value() {
if [ ${#} -ne 2 ]; then
echo -e "${RED}Error${NC}: Invalid arguments${NC}"
echo -e "Usage: $0 debug_name debug_value"
exit 1
fi
local debug_name="$1"; shift
local debug_value="$1"; shift
# echo to stderr so we don't polute stdout which causes issues
# for funcs that return via stdout
echo -e "${DGREY}DEBUG ${debug_name}: [${debug_value}]${NC}" >&2
}
# Requires setup_debuging to be run once
debug() {
# echo to stderr so we don't polute stdout which causes issues
# for funcs that return via stdout
# shellcheck disable=SC2317
echo -e "${DGREY}DEBUG $* ${NC}" >&2
}
verify_http_link() {
local source_file="$1"; shift
local link_name="$1"; shift
local link_location="$1"; shift
# 'http://domain.com/path "title"' => 'http://domain.com/path'
local link_url="${link_location%% \"*}"
if [[ ! ${checked_links_map[${link_url}]} ]]; then
echo -e "${indent}${NC}Checking URL ${NC}${link_url}${NC}"
local response_code
response_code="$( \
curl \
--silent \
--head \
--location \
--output /dev/null \
--write-out "%{http_code}" \
"${link_url}" \
|| echo "" \
)"
if [[ "${response_code}" =~ ^2 ]]; then
# Link is good so add to our set/map so we don't have to hit it again
checked_links_map["${link_url}"]=1
new_checked_links_map["${link_url}"]=1
else
# Some sites don't seem to like the --head option so try it again
# but getting the full page.
response_code="$( \
curl \
--silent \
--location \
--output /dev/null \
--write-out "%{http_code}" \
"${link_url}" \
|| echo "" \
)"
if [[ "${response_code}" =~ ^2 ]]; then
# Link is good so add to our set/map so we don't have to hit it again
checked_links_map["${link_url}"]=1
new_checked_links_map["${link_url}"]=1
else
log_broken_http_link \
"${source_file}" \
"${link_name}" \
"${link_url}" \
"${response_code}"
fi
fi
else
echo -e "${indent}${NC}Already Checked URL ${NC}${link_url}${NC}"
fi
}

log_broken_http_link() {
local source_file="$1"; shift
local link_name="$1"; shift
local url="$1"; shift
local response_code="$1"; shift
#problem_count=$((problem_count + 1))
local msg="Found broken link in file ${BLUE}${source_file}${NC} \
with name ${BLUE}${link_name}${NC} and link URL \
${BLUE}${url}${NC}, response: ${BLUE}${response_code}${NC}"
echo -e "${indent}${RED}Error${NC}: ${msg}"
error_messages+=( "${msg}" )
}
verify_link() {
local source_file="$1"; shift
local line_no="$1"; shift
local link_name="$1"; shift
local link_location="$1"; shift
if [[ "${link_location}" =~ ^http ]]; then
if [[ ${url_deny_list_map["${link_location}"]+_} ]]; then
echo -e "${indent}${YELLOW}Ignoring deny-listed link" \
"[${BLUE}${link_name}${YELLOW}]" \
"with url [${BLUE}${link_location}${YELLOW}]${NC}"
elif [[ "${link_location}" == *"www.plantuml.com/plantuml/proxy"* ]]; then
echo -e "${indent}${YELLOW}Unable to check plantuml link" \
"[${BLUE}${link_name}${YELLOW}]" \
"with url [${BLUE}${link_location}${YELLOW}]${NC}"
elif [[ "${link_location}" =~ (localhost|127.0.0.1) ]]; then
echo -e "${indent}${YELLOW}Unable to check localhost link" \
"[${BLUE}${link_name}${YELLOW}]" \
"with url [${BLUE}${link_location}${YELLOW}]${NC}"
elif [[ "${link_location}" =~ www\.somehost\.com ]]; then
: # noop
#echo -e "${indent}${YELLOW}Ignoring dummy link" \
#"[${BLUE}${link_name}${YELLOW}]" \
#"with url [${BLUE}${link_location}${YELLOW}]${NC}"
elif [[ "${link_location}" =~ @@VERSION@@ ]]; then
echo -e "${indent}${YELLOW}Unable to check versioned link" \
"[${BLUE}${link_name}${YELLOW}]" \
"with url [${BLUE}${link_location}${YELLOW}]${NC}"
else
# HTTP link
# We can't verify the plant uml links as the file in the link may not exist
# on github yet
#echo -e "${indent}${GREEN}Checking http link [${BLUE}${link_name}${GREEN}]" \
#"with url [${BLUE}${link_location}${GREEN}]${NC}"
verify_http_link "${file}" "${link_name}" "${link_location}"
fi
fi
}
parse_link() {
local line_no="$1"; shift
local link="$1"; shift
local link_name
# [xxx](yyy "zzz") => [xxx
link_name="${link%%\]\(*}"
# [xxx => xxx
link_name="${link_name#*\[}";
local link_location
# [xxx](yyy "zzz") => yyy "zzz")
link_location="${link#*\]\(}"
# yyy "zzz") => yyy "zzz"
link_location="${link_location%%\)}";
# yyy "zzz" => yyy
link_location="${link_location% \"*\"}";
debug_value "link" "${link}"
debug_value "link_name" "${link_name}"
debug_value "link_location" "${link_location}"
debug_value "line_no" "${line_no}"
verify_link "${file}" "${line_no}" "${link_name}" "${link_location}"
}
check_links_in_file() {
local file="$1"; shift
echo -e "${GREEN}Checking file ${BLUE}${file}${NC}"
check_basic_links_in_file "${file}"
check_external_links_in_file "${file}"
}
check_basic_links_in_file() {
local file="$1"; shift
#local links
#links="$( \
#grep \
#--perl-regexp \
#--only-matching \
#"\[[^\]]*?\]\([^)]+?\)" \
#"${file}" \
#|| echo ""
#)"
#echo -e "links:\n${links}"
# Not using herestring as it seemt to mess up syntax hlighting in vim
# Find all the markdown links e.g.
# [Name](./path/file.md#heading-anchor "Title")
# Also ignore ones like [...](?...) as these appear in link.md fence
# blocks. Bit of a hack, but ignoring text inside fences would be
# a bit of an adventure in bash.
while read -r grep_line; do
debug_value "grep_line" "${grep_line}"
if [[ -n "${grep_line}" ]]; then
# grep line looks like:
# 6:[Properties](../../user-guide/properties.md)
# So parse out the line no and link
local line_no="${grep_line%%:*}"
local link="${grep_line#*:}"
debug_value "line_no" "${line_no}"
debug_value "link" "${link}"
parse_link "${line_no}" "${link}"
link_count=$((link_count + 1))
fi
done < <(grep \
--line-number \
--perl-regexp \
--only-matching \
"\[[^\]]*?\]\([^?)][^)]*?\)" \
"${file}" \
|| echo "")
}
check_external_links_in_file() {
local file="$1"; shift
#local links
#links="$( \
#grep \
#--perl-regexp \
#--only-matching \
#"\[[^\]]*?\]\([^)]+?\)" \
#"${file}" \
#|| echo ""
#)"
#echo -e "links:\n${links}"
# Not using herestring as it seemt to mess up syntax hlighting in vim
# Find all the markdown links e.g.
# [Name](./path/file.md#heading-anchor "Title")
# Also ignore ones like [...](?...) as these appear in link.md fence
# blocks. Bit of a hack, but ignoring text inside fences would be
# a bit of an adventure in bash.
local bash_regex='\{\{< ?external-link "(.*)" "(.*)" ?>\}\}'
while read -r grep_line; do
debug_value "grep_line" "${grep_line}"
if [[ -n "${grep_line}" ]]; then
# grep line looks like:
# 6:{{< external-link "My Title" "https://www.elastic....." >}}
# So parse out the line no and link
local line_no="${grep_line%%:*}"
local link="${grep_line#*:}"
debug_value "line_no" "${line_no}"
debug_value "link" "${link}"
if [[ "${link}" =~ ${bash_regex} ]]; then
link_name="${BASH_REMATCH[1]}"
link_location="${BASH_REMATCH[2]}"
debug_value "link_name" "${link_name}"
debug_value "link_location" "${link_location}"
verify_link "${file}" "${line_no}" "${link_name}" "${link_location}"
else
echo -e "${indent}${RED}Error${NC}: Found external link in file" \
"${BLUE}${source_file}${NC} at line ${BLUE}${line_no}${NC} that" \
"couldn't be parsed: '${BLUE}${grep_line}${NC}'"
fi
parse_link "${line_no}" "${link}"
link_count=$((link_count + 1))
fi
done < <(grep \
--line-number \
--perl-regexp \
--only-matching \
'\{\{< ?external-link ".*?" ".*?" ?>\}\}' \
"${file}" \
|| echo "")
}

main() {
if [[ $# -gt 0 ]]; then
local named_file="${1}"; shift
fi
IS_DEBUG="${IS_DEBUG:-false}"
SCRIPT_DIR="$( cd "$( dirname "${BASH_SOURCE[0]}" )" >/dev/null && pwd )"
CONTENT_DIR="${SCRIPT_DIR}/content"
# Use today's date so we know the urls were ok today
CHECKED_URLS_FILE=/tmp/stroom_docs_checked_urls_$(date +%Y%m%d)
setup_echo_colours
setup_debuging
local repo_root
repo_root="$(git rev-parse --show-toplevel)"
pushd "${repo_root}" > /dev/null
debug_value "PWD" "${PWD}"
#local problem_count=0
local error_messages=()
#declare -A file_and_anchor_map
local file_count=0
local link_count=0
# Associative array of urls that have been checked and found
# to be good. Also gets pre-populated from file (if present)
local -A checked_links_map
# Associative array of urls that have been checked and found
# to be good.
local -A new_checked_links_map
# Import known good URLs if the file is present. This is to speed
# up builds where we build multiple versions of the docs.
if [[ -f "${CHECKED_URLS_FILE}" && "${force:-false}" = false ]]; then
echo -e "${GREEN}Importing known good URLs from" \
"${BLUE}${CHECKED_URLS_FILE}${NC}"
while IFS= read -r url; do
if [[ -n "${url}" ]]; then
echo -e "${indent}${GREEN}Imported URL ${BLUE}${url}${NC}"
checked_links_map["${url}"]=1
fi
done < "${CHECKED_URLS_FILE}"
echo -e "${GREEN}Imported ${BLUE}${#checked_links_map[@]}${GREEN} checked URLs"
fi
local -A file_deny_list_map
for file in "${file_deny_list[@]}"; do
file_deny_list_map[${file}]=1
done
local -A url_deny_list_map
for file in "${url_deny_list[@]}"; do
url_deny_list_map[${file}]=1
done
#echo -e "${GREEN}Scanning all .md files to find headings${NC}"
## Loop over all files and build a map of all file heading combos
#for file in ./**/*.md; do
## shellcheck disable=SC1001
#if [[ ! "${file}" =~ \/node_modules\/ ]] \
#&& [[ ! ${file_deny_list_map["${file}"]+_} ]]; then
#debug_value "file" "${file}"
## An associative array to hold all anchors for this file
## so we can check for dups
#declare -A single_file_anchors_map
#find_headings "${file}"
#find_anchors "${file}"
#file_count=$((file_count + 1))
#else
#debug "Skipping file ${file}"
#fi
#done
if [[ -n "${named_file}" ]]; then
if [[ ! -f "${named_file}" ]]; then
echo -e "${indent}${RED}ERROR${NC}: File ${BLUE}${named_file}${NC}" \
"doesn't exist${NC}"
exit 1
fi
if [[ ! ${file_deny_list_map["${named_file}"]+_} ]]; then
check_links_in_file "${named_file}"
else
echo -e "${indent}${YELLOW}Ignoring deny-listed file" \
"[${BLUE}${named_file}${YELLOW}]${NC}"
fi
else
# Now loop over all files again and verify the links in the files
echo -e "${GREEN}Scanning all .md files to check links${NC}"
for file in "${CONTENT_DIR}"/**/*.md; do
# shellcheck disable=SC1001
if [[ ! "${file}" =~ \/node_modules\/ ]] \
&& [[ ! ${file_deny_list_map["${file}"]+_} ]]; then
check_links_in_file "${file}"
fi
done
fi
# Write all the associative array keys to a file so we can re-use them
if [[ -f "${CHECKED_URLS_FILE}" ]]; then
# Already got a file so add only new ones seen in this run of the script
for url in "${!new_checked_links_map[@]}"; do
echo "${url}" >> "${CHECKED_URLS_FILE}"
done
echo -e "${GREEN}Written ${#new_checked_links_map[@]} checked URLs" \
"to ${BLUE}${CHECKED_URLS_FILE}${NC}"
else
touch "${CHECKED_URLS_FILE}"
for url in "${!checked_links_map[@]}"; do
echo "${url}" >> "${CHECKED_URLS_FILE}"
done
echo -e "${GREEN}Written ${#checked_links_map[@]} checked URLs" \
"to ${BLUE}${CHECKED_URLS_FILE}${NC}"
fi
echo -e "${GREEN}File count: ${BLUE}${file_count}${NC}"
echo -e "${GREEN}Link count: ${BLUE}${link_count}${NC}"
#echo -e "${GREEN}Heading count: ${BLUE}${#file_and_anchor_map[@]}${NC}"
# Test array size
local problem_count="${#error_messages[@]}"
if [[ "${problem_count}" -gt 0 ]]; then
echo -e "${indent}${RED}ERROR${NC}: Found ${BLUE}${problem_count}${NC}" \
"problems with links and anchors. See details below:${NC}"
for msg in "${error_messages[@]}"; do
echo
echo -e "${indent}${msg}"
done
exit 1
else
echo -e "${GREEN}All checks completed with no problems found${NC}"
exit 0
fi
}
main "$@"
